First NO2 measurements by car-DOAS instrument in Minsk
Abstract
The work is dedicated to the car-DOAS instrument that has been developed in Research Institute of Applied Physical Problems, BSU and its application for NO2 vertical column retrieval. The instrument is based on own production spectrometer with concave holographic diffraction grating and non-cooled CCD-array detector. The instrument is employing in spectral range of 340 - 600 nm and FWHM = 4.5 nm. The optical fiber radiation input system with zenith geometry has been implemented. The comparison results with reference instrument will be presented and discussed. Reference instrument successfully took part in MAD-CAT (2013) and CINDI-2 (2016) international inter-comparison campaigns. It has spectral range of 320 - 400 nm and FWHM = 0.32 nm. First mobile measurements around the Minsk aiming to retrieve NO2 emission power of the city have been carried out. Obtained results have been compared with Belarusian Hydro-meteorological Centre data and satellite data; corresponding results will be presented and discussed.
